What is the difference between Remote Art Collection Management vs Remote Art Registrar?

AspectRemote Art Collection ManagementRemote Art Registrar
CredentialsKnowledge of art history, collection care, and catalogingSimilar, often requires knowledge of cataloging and documentation
Work EnvironmentManaging collections, coordinating with institutions remotelyMaintaining records, updating databases, and documentation
Industry UsageUsed in museums, galleries, private collectionsCommon in museums, art institutions, and galleries

Remote Art Collection Management involves overseeing and curating art collections, focusing on acquisition, preservation, and overall management. Remote Art Registrar primarily handles documentation, cataloging, and record-keeping of artworks. While both roles require knowledge of art and cataloging, collection managers focus on the broader management and strategic aspects, whereas registrars concentrate on accurate record-keeping and database maintenance.

Data Management / Data Analysis Specialist

Integrated Business & Technical Consultants

Vienna, VA • Remote

Full-time

Posted 11 days ago


Job description

Integrated Business & Technical Consultants, Inc. (IBTCI), a U.S.-based international development consulting company established in 1987, has worked in over 100 countries and implemented over 300 projects. IBTCI serves government agencies, private-sector companies, and donor organizations. IBTCI specializes in monitoring, evaluation, research, and learning (MERL) and institutional support across sectors including conflict and crisis, democracy and governance, agriculture, economic growth, food security, education, environment, and global health.

Assignment Title: Data Management / Data Analysis Specialist

Department/Location: Remote, with possible travel to target countries

Technical Point of Contact: Team Leader

Type: Consultant, Short-term / Intermittent

Classification: Consultancy

Overview: IBTCI is seeking a Data Management / Data Analysis Specialist to support a proposed Livelihoods Framework and Evaluations assignment. The specialist will program and code data-collection instruments; establish secure, well-documented data flows; process incoming qualitative and quantitative data; conduct cleaning, quality control, analysis, and visualization; and support consistent reporting across 13 project evaluations. The role requires careful management of concurrent country datasets and transparent, reproducible analytical workflows.

Essential Duties/Tasks and Responsibilities:

  • Translate approved questionnaires, interview guides, checklists, and scorecards into reliable electronic data-collection instruments using appropriate platforms.
  • Program skip logic, range and consistency checks, required fields, unique identifiers, consent gates, language versions, metadata, and secure submission workflows.
  • Develop and maintain data-management plans, data dictionaries, codebooks, file-naming conventions, access controls, version-control procedures, and data-retention and destruction protocols.
  • Receive, inventory, merge, de-identify, and securely store quantitative and qualitative data from field teams, implementing organizations, and secondary sources.
  • Perform daily or scheduled data-quality checks for completeness, duplication, missingness, outliers, logical inconsistencies, interview duration, enumerator patterns, and protocol deviations; document and resolve queries with field teams.
  • Clean, recode, label, derive, and prepare analysis-ready datasets while preserving raw data and a transparent audit trail of all transformations.
  • Prepare quantitative tabulations and statistical outputs and support qualitative coding, codebook management, retrieval, and thematic analysis.
  • Integrate qualitative and quantitative evidence into triangulation matrices and maintain evidence links supporting scorecard ratings, findings, conclusions, and recommendations.
  • Create clear tables, charts, and other data visualizations for monthly updates, evaluation reports, scorecards, slide decks, and stakeholder presentations.
  • Protect confidentiality and personally identifiable information and comply with approved IRB, consent, safeguarding, data-protection, and implementing-organization requirements.

Minimum Qualifications:

  • At least 5 years of professional experience in evaluation data management, research data processing, quantitative or qualitative analysis, or a closely related function.
  • Demonstrated experience programming or coding electronic data-collection instruments and implementing field validation and skip logic.
  • Experience cleaning, quality-checking, merging, labeling, and documenting multi-source datasets from surveys, interviews, focus groups, checklists, or administrative records.
  • Proficiency in Excel and at least one quantitative analysis package such as SPSS, Stata, R, or Python.
  • Experience with at least one electronic data-collection platform such as KoboToolbox, SurveyCTO, ODK, Qualtrics, REDCap, or a comparable system.
  • Experience with qualitative data coding or qualitative analysis software, or demonstrated ability to manage coded qualitative datasets.
  • Ability to produce accurate, accessible, decision-oriented data visualizations and tables.
  • Strong attention to detail, documentation, data security, and deadline management.
  • Excellent written and oral communication skills in English.

Education: Bachelor's degree in statistics, data science, information systems, economics, social sciences, evaluation, public policy, or another relevant field.

Preferred Knowledge, Skills, and Abilities:

  • Master's degree in a relevant field.
  • Experience supporting multi-country livelihoods, humanitarian, agriculture, food security, or economic-development evaluations.
  • Experience in low-connectivity, multilingual, fragile, or conflict-affected field settings.

Work environment: This position is primarily remote and computer-based and requires secure handling of confidential evaluation data.
